Yesterday I got into my first car accident, It was raining and I was about to make a left turn (with my signal on) and someone rear ended me. There was no damage but my head hit the seat.. I didn't feel any pain until this morning when I woke up.
We did not exchange information because there was no damage, but now I am having really bad neck pain. Also, When I lay down and try to get back up, it hurts so bad that I can't move without help.
I know I should have gotten his information and I really regret that. Does this sound like something that I should go to the doctor for or will it go away on it's own?

Could be some minor whiplash. If it still hurts in a few days see a doctor. You really should get information after any accident, no matter how insignificant it may seem. |

Whiplash. Either see a doctor or take a few tylenol or aspirin. The stiffness and soreness should go away in a couple of days. If it doesn't, you need to file a report with your insurance company and seek treatment for a possible neck injury. Above all, be honest with the insurance company. You aren't required to report ALL traffic accidents but is is wise to do so. |
